Thornton, CO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Thornton?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Thornton Luxury Studio Apartments | $1,657 | $985 | $2,097 |
Thornton Luxury 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,799 | $698 | $5,521 |
Thornton Luxury 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,173 | $1,092 | $6,785 |
Thornton Luxury 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,033 | $1,514 | $10,000+ |
Thornton Luxury 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,902 | $2,040 | $3,699 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Thornton
How much are Studio apartments in Thornton?
There are currently 24 Studio Apartments in Thornton with rent ranges from $985 to $2,097 with an average price of $1,657.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Thornton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Thornton ranges from $698 to $5,521 with an average monthly rent of $1,799.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Thornton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Thornton range from $1,092 to $6,785.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,173.
How expensive are Thornton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 87 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Thornton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,514 to $12,368 - averaging $3,033 for the location.
